What is this machine used for?
The SP-830-A is a solder paste stencil printer (also called a solder paste screen printer) used at the front end of an SMT assembly line. Its job is to apply solder paste onto the copper pads of a bare PCB through a stencil, so that SMD components placed downstream will solder reliably in reflow.
In stencil printing, the quality of the paste deposit determines a large share of final solder-joint yield. Too little paste causes dry joints and opens; too much paste causes solder balls, bridges, and tombstoning. The SP-830-A is designed to make that step repeatable: the operator programs the print parameters — squeegee speed, pressure, snap-off, and print stroke — and the machine reproduces them board after board.

How It Integrates into a Complete PCB Assembly Line
The SP-830-A occupies the first station of a standard SMT line. A typical Southern Machinery line layout looks like this:
- Stencil printing (SP-830-A) — apply solder paste to the bare PCB
- SMT placement — chip mounter / pick-and-place places SMD components onto the pasted pads
- Reflow oven — the assembly is heated so the solder paste melts and forms the joints
- AOI / inspection — automated optical inspection checks placement and joint quality
- THT insertion (if mixed-technology board) — radial, axial, or odd-form insertion machines add through-hole parts
- Wave soldering — through-hole joints are soldered in a lead-free or standard wave
- Board handling — PCB loaders, conveyors, unloaders, and depaneling link the stations
For a mixed SMT/THT product — for example an LED driver with SMD control chips plus through-hole capacitors — the SP-830-A starts the SMD portion, and Southern Machinery's insertion and wave-soldering machines finish the through-hole portion. All stations can be configured as a coordinated line with shared board handling.
Key Selection Parameters
When evaluating a solder paste stencil printer like the SP-830-A, confirm these parameters against your production requirements:
| Parameter | What to confirm |
|-----------|-----------------|
| PCB size range | Minimum and maximum board dimensions the printer supports |
| Print area / stencil size | Largest stencil frame and print area your boards need |
| Squeegee system | Metal or rubber squeegee, and whether pressure is adjustable/programmable |
| Alignment method | Vision alignment vs. mechanical registration, and required repeatability |
| Programming interface | Recipe storage, teach-in workflow, and ease of changeover |
| Automation level | Manual, semi-automatic, or automatic board loading |
| Throughput | Print cycles per hour needed for your line balance |
| Facility requirements | Power, compressed air, and floor space in your factory |

ROI, Quality & Throughput Perspective
Switching from manual paste application (squeegee by hand or simple bench printers) to a programmed stencil printer changes the economics of the printing step:
- Consistency — programmed squeegee speed and pressure remove operator-to-operator variation, which directly reduces print defects such as smearing, insufficient paste, and bridging
- Rework savings — fewer paste defects means fewer boards caught at AOI, less rework labor, and less scrapped material
- Setup speed — saved print recipes let operators recall parameters for repeat jobs in minutes instead of re-tuning by trial and error
- Labor — one operator can manage the printer and the upstream board handling, freeing skilled labor for placement and inspection
- Line balance — with a stable, repeatable first step, downstream placement and reflow run without starving or piling up, improving overall throughput
